🎉 Use coupon MYXERO to enjoy 20% recurring discount on any plan. View Pricing
EU Withdrawal Button for WooCommerce
EU Withdrawal Button for WooCommerce

EU Withdrawal Button for WooCommerce

0/5 (0 ratings) 10 active installs Updated Apr 24, 2026
Sticky bar with withdrawal button on the storefront

Sticky bar with withdrawal button on the storefront

EU Directive 2023/2673 introduces new requirements for online stores regarding consumer withdrawal rights, taking effect on June 19, 2026.

EU Withdrawal Button for WooCommerce helps you implement a clear, accessible withdrawal flow for your customers:

The 4-Step Flow

  1. Visible Button — Sticky bar with a withdrawal button on every page
  2. Withdrawal Form — Customer enters order number + email for verification
  3. Confirmation Step — Order summary with a separate “Confirm withdrawal” button
  4. Notifications — Confirmation email to customer + notification to merchant

Features

  • Sticky bar with configurable text and button
  • Modal popup or dedicated page mode
  • Order validation (order number + email + 14-day window check)
  • Custom WooCommerce order status: “Withdrawal Requested”
  • WooCommerce email integration (shows in WooCommerce Settings Emails)
  • Support for custom order number plugins (Sequential Order Numbers, etc.)
  • WCAG 2.1 AA accessible (keyboard navigation, focus trap, ARIA labels)
  • Rate limiting for abuse prevention
  • Translation-ready with .pot file
  • HPOS (High-Performance Order Storage) compatible

Who Is This For?

WooCommerce store owners who sell to EU consumers and want to provide a clear withdrawal process for their customers.

Disclaimer

This plugin is a technical tool that helps implement a withdrawal flow. It does not constitute legal advice and does not guarantee compliance with any specific regulation. Consult a legal professional to ensure your store meets all applicable requirements.